A zone plate is illuminated with parallel laser light. The focal points of several orders of the zone plate are projected on a ground glass screen.

Tasks
The laser beam must be widened so that the zone plate is well illuminated. It must be assured that the laser lightbeam runs parallel over several meters.
The focal points of several orders of the zone plate are projected on a ground glass screen. The focal lengths to be determined are plotted against the reciprocal value of their order.
